West Indies Face Must-Win ODI Series With World Cup Qualification at Stake

0
·1 views

West Indies enter their upcoming ODI series under significant pressure as World Cup qualification hangs in the balance. A strong performance in this series is critical for the team to secure their spot in the tournament. New Zealand, their opponents, also have motivation heading into the series after suffering a defeat to Bangladesh in their most recent ODI assignment. The Kiwis will be looking to return to winning form and restore confidence following that setback. Both sides therefore approach the series with contrasting but equally compelling reasons to perform well.

Bangladesh vs Zimbabwe: Both Teams Make Key Bowling Changes for the Match

Bangladesh opted to bowl first after winning the toss in their match against Zimbabwe. The visitors made notable omissions, leaving out fast bowler Nahid Rana and leg-spinner Rishad Hossain from their playing XI. Zimbabwe also made significant changes, resting pace spearhead Blessing Muzarabani and Newman Nyamhuri. In the absence of Richard Ngarava, Sikandar Raza leads the Zimbabwe side for this fixture.

Santner backs Duffy to lead New Zealand's pace attack against West Indies

New Zealand spinner Mitchell Santner has expressed confidence in seamer Jacob Duffy to spearhead the team's bowling attack in the upcoming ODI series against West Indies. The endorsement comes as New Zealand are without several of their top pace bowlers, who are sidelined due to injuries and workload management. Duffy, as the most experienced seamer available in the squad, is expected to shoulder greater responsibility with the new ball. Santner's backing highlights the trust the team's leadership has placed in Duffy to step up in the absence of New Zealand's first-choice quicks.

MI New York beat Seattle Orcas in stunning comeback powered by Tajinder and Pollard

MI New York pulled off a remarkable come-from-behind victory against Seattle Orcas in a Major League Cricket match. Tajinder and Kieron Pollard were the standout performers for MI New York, leading the team's winning effort with key contributions. Despite a strong showing from Seattle, including an impressive 81 from Seifert and a five-wicket haul by Stoinis, the Orcas ultimately collapsed and could not hold on to win. The defeat was particularly painful for Seattle given how dominant their individual performances had been earlier in the game. MI New York's ability to absorb pressure and fight back proved decisive in securing the result.
